To understand the destination, we must first understand the vehicle. Bit.ly is one of the world’s most popular URL shortening services. Founded in 2008, it rose to prominence during the early days of Twitter, when character counts were strictly limited to 140. Users needed a way to share links without sacrificing half their message to a long URL.

Bit.ly solves this by taking a long URL (e.g., www.examplewebsite.com/articles/2023/11/how-to-bake-cake ) and converting it into a compact format (e.g., bit.ly/bake-cake ). However, custom "back-halves" (the text after the slash) are a paid or specific feature. The vast majority of Bit.ly links use a randomly generated string of alphanumeric characters.
